Can I Save for College and Retirement at the Same Time?

Retirement Planning in 2025 – How the SECURE 2.0 May Benefit Your Retirement Strategy

Retirement rules continue to evolve, and 2025 brings several important updates that could affect how much you save, when you access your funds, and how you manage taxes in retirement. Recent changes under the SECURE 2.0 Act have increased contribution limits, introduced new catch-up opportunities for older savers, and pushed back the age for required minimum distributions (RMDs).

Stop Giving the Government an Interest-Free Loan: Understanding Your Paycheck and Tax Withholding

A tax refund isn’t a bonus—it’s proof you overpaid the IRS. By understanding your paycheck—earnings, pre-tax deductions, taxes, and net pay—you can adjust your federal withholding and keep more money in your pocket each month. For example, one couple discovered they’d loaned the government $7,000 interest-free. With the right strategy, that money could boost savings, investments, or debt payoff. Mid-Year Market Check-In: Navigating Volatility Without Losing Focus

Peter Lynch once said, “If you spend more than 13 minutes analyzing forecasts, you’ve wasted 10.” His advice: ignore the noise and focus on your strategy. Mid-2025 returns show the S&P 500 up 8.1%, Nasdaq up 9.1%, Dow up 5%, Russell up 2.3%, and MSCI EAFE up 20%. Tech leaders like Nvidia and Microsoft boosted gains, while Apple and Tesla lagged. Diversification remains key. Stay the course—volatility is the cost of strong long-term returns.

Ohio Income Tax is Dropping: Here’s What You Need to Know for 2025, 2026, and Beyond

Starting in 2025, Ohio will lower its top income tax rate from 3.5% to 3.125% and shift to a flat 2.75% rate in 2026 for income over $26,050—making it the 2nd lowest state income tax in the U.S. among taxed states. Understanding Trump Accounts: A New Wealth-Building Opportunity for the Next Generation

A new provision in the tax bill creates “Trump Accounts” for babies born between 2025–2028, starting with a $1,000 government deposit and allowing up to $5,000/year in contributions. Invested in a stock index fund, these accounts could grow into millions by age 50 through consistent saving and compounding.
